Poison Billiards Becomes Title Sponsor of 9-Ball Tour for Professional and Amateur Pool Players

JACKSONVILLE, Fla. (May 7, 2010) – Starting with the next stop on the Florida tour, Poison Billiards is the title sponsor of the highly successful 9-Ball tour managed by top professional player Tony Crosby. The tour, which has run continuously since September 2008, brings professional and amateur pool players together, and averages 20 stops throughout Florida annually.
 
“This 9-Ball tour has been successful since its inception because it uniquely blends both amateur and professional players, encourages interaction, and creates a great playing experience,” said Karim Belhaj, president and CEO of Predator Group. “Poison Billiards is a perfect sponsor for this tour as we have as our key objective to bring players of all levels together and to offer great products to all players that helps them pocket more balls.”
 
Each two-day event on the Poison 9-Ball Tour takes place on a weekend with an average of 100 players participating. Registration fees range from $15 to $90, and every winner receives prize money and a trophy.
